What is HSBC Assets Review
The HSBC Net Personal Assets Review Form is a financial document used by HSBC customers to request a review of their net personal assets for the purpose of continuing or reinstating unsecured facilities.

What is the HSBC Net Personal Assets Review Form?
The HSBC Net Personal Assets Review Form is designed for HSBC customers to evaluate their financial standing by analyzing their net personal assets. This form collects vital information, including personal particulars, income details, assets, and liabilities, ensuring a comprehensive assessment. Customers looking to optimize their financial support through unsecured facilities will find this form essential in communicating their financial profile to HSBC.
Purpose and Benefits of the HSBC Net Personal Assets Review Form
This form assists customers in initiating a review process for unsecured credit facilities based on their financial situation. By submitting the HSBC assets review form, individuals can potentially secure a higher credit limit that is reflective of their assessed net personal assets. Benefits include increased access to financial support tailored to individual needs, information transparency, and the opportunity for a tailored banking experience.
Who Needs the HSBC Net Personal Assets Review Form?
Existing HSBC customers seeking to reassess their financial situation, particularly after significant changes in income or asset status, should consider using this form. Scenarios that necessitate a review include job changes, inheritance, or substantial expenditure that impacts financial stability. It’s imperative for these customers to understand when a review might be beneficial for their financial planning.
Eligibility Criteria for the HSBC Net Personal Assets Review Form
To be eligible to submit the HSBC Net Personal Assets Review Form, applicants must meet specific requirements which include having an active account with HSBC. Both the main applicant and any joint applicants must provide accurate information regarding their financial situation and be willing to sign the documentation. Meeting these eligibility criteria is crucial for a smooth review process.

Who is eligible to fill out the HSBC Net Personal Assets Review Form?
The form is designed for HSBC customers who are main or joint applicants requesting a review of their net personal assets for unsecured facilities.
What documents do I need to submit with this form?
Required documents typically include proof of income, details of personal assets and liabilities, and any other information specified by HSBC in the form instructions.
How do I submit the completed form?
After completing the form, you can submit it to HSBC by mailing it to the specified address included in the form or following any digital submission procedures outlined.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include omitting required fields, incorrect income reporting, and not reviewing the form for errors before submission.
Is there a deadline for submitting the HSBC Net Personal Assets Review Form?
While specific deadlines may not be provided, it is essential to submit the form promptly to ensure timely processing of your request for unsecured facilities.
How long does it take to process the review after submitting the form?
Processing times can vary. Generally, expect a response within a few weeks, but it's advisable to check with HSBC for specific timing.
